WinBugs version 1.4 user manual 
Spiegelhalter, D; Thomas, A; Best, N; Lunn, D 
2003 
MRC Biostatistics Unit 
Cambridge, UK 
This manual describes the WinBUGS software - an interactive Windows version of the BUGS program for Bayesian analysis of complex statistical models using Markov chain Monte Carlo (MCMC) techniques. WinBUGS allows models to be described using a slightly amended version of the BUGS language, or as Doodles (graphical representations of models) which can, if desired, be translated to a text-based description. The BUGS language is more flexible than the Doodles.
